About this route:
A direct, nonstop flight between Ambilobe Airport (AMB), Ambilobe, Madagascar and Laughlin Air Force Base (DLF), Del Rio, Texas, United States would travel a Great Circle distance of 10,203 miles (or 16,420 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Ambilobe Airport and Laughlin Air Force Base, the route shown on this map most likely appears curved because of this reason.

Facts about Laughlin Air Force Base (DLF):
- Laughlin AFB is served by the San Felipe Del Rio Consolidated Independent School District.
- Park University offers onsite and online classes on base.
- The Air Force transferred jurisdiction of the base to the Strategic Air Command on April 1, 1957 and the 4080th Strategic Reconnaissance Wing moved there from Turner Air Force Base, Georgia.
- The closest airport to Laughlin Air Force Base (DLF) is Del Rio International Airport (DRT), which is located only 9 miles (15 kilometers) W of DLF.
- Laughlin U-2s were among the first to provide photographic evidence of Soviet missile installations in Cuba in 1962 when 4080th U-2 pilot Major Steve Heyser flew his U-2C over Cuba after taking off from Edwards AFB, California.
- The furthest airport from Laughlin Air Force Base (DLF) is Sir Gaëtan Duval Airport (RRG), which is located 11,241 miles (18,091 kilometers) away in Rodrigues Island, Mauritius.
- As of the census of 2014, there were 2,225 people, 651 households, and 570 families residing on the base.
